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ary terms help you understand the terms commonly used in SJS complication cases. This section provides brief definitions and plain-language explanations to support your discussions with our team and any medical or financial experts involved.

Mucositis

Mucositis refers to inflammation and breakdown of mucous membranes, often occurring in the mouth or genital areas following certain medical treatments or procedures. In legal discussions, mucositis is a factor in evaluating pain, healing time, and the potential impact on quality of life, which can influence compensation considerations and care needs.

Scarring

Scarring describes the natural healing response that leaves visible marks or tissue changes after injury. In these cases, scarring can affect physical comfort, appearance, and self-esteem, potentially contributing to damages estimates and the overall compensation sought through the legal process.

Damages

Damages refer to the financial compensation sought for medical bills, ongoing care, lost wages, and other losses resulting from the condition. Understanding damages helps you assess the scope of your claim and communicate needs clearly during negotiations and potential litigation.

Statute of Limitations

The statute of limitations sets the time limit to file a legal action after an event or injury. Timely action is essential to preserve your rights. Our team explains deadlines and helps you organize evidence so your claim remains viable.

Stevens-Johnson syndrome (SJS) represents a severe and potentially life-threatening condition that impacts the skin and mucous membranes. When this condition progresses to its most dangerous variant, toxic epidermal necrolysis (TEN), mortality rates can range from 30-80%. In most cases, these reactions stem from adverse responses to pharmaceutical medications.

What is mucositis and how might it affect a claim?

Mucositis is inflammation of mucous membranes that can occur after certain treatments. This condition can affect oral and genital regions, influencing pain levels, healing time, and medical costs. When these effects are tied to a medical event, a claim may help recover related damages and support your recovery journey. A careful review of records is essential to determine eligibility and options.
